Bread Upma / Savory Bread Saute - Instant Pot, Stove Top

Jyoti Behrani
Bread Upma or Savory Bread Saute is a quick and easy Indian breakfast or snack recipe. Bread upma is made using bread, a twist to a classic umpa recipe.

Ingredients
  

  • 10 slices white bread cut into small pieces
  • 1 medium onion chopped
  • 1 medium potato chopped
  • 2 small tomato chopped
  • 1 green chili optional
  • 2 tablespoon oil
  • 1 teaspoon turmeric powder
  • ½ teaspoon red chili powder as per taste
  • ¾ - 1 cup water check recipe notes
  • salt to taste

For garnish:

  • Handful of fresh cilantro

Instructions
 

Instructions for Instant Pot Cooking:

  • Turn on Instant Pot to saute mode (high).
  • When it displays "HOT", add oil, onion, saute for 1-2 mins.
  • Add potatoes, tomatoes, green chili, turmeric powder, red chili powder, salt to taste. Saute for 2-3 mins
  • Add water. De-glaze the pot. Turn off Instant Pot. Close the IP lid, vent sealed.
  • Turn on Manual/Pressure cook mode (high), "1" mins.
  • Note: Cook time "ONE" min is not a typo!! Check recipe notes for details.
  • Let pressure release naturally, around 5 mins. Open the IP lid.
  • Turn on saute mode (high).
  • Bring the mixture to a gentle boil. Turn off IP.
  • Add bread pieces. Mix gently. Let the bread soak the flavors for 2-3 mins before serving.
  • Garnish with some fresh cilantro and serve hot. Enjoy!!

Instructions for Stove Top Cooking:

  • On a high heat, in a pot, add oil, onion, saute for 1-2 mins.
  • Add potatoes, tomatoes, green chili, turmeric powder, red chili powder, salt to taste. Saute for 2-3 mins.
  • Reduce the heat to low, cover and cook until potatoes are completely cooked. Mix occasionally.
  • Add water. De-glaze the pot.
  • Bring the mixture to a boil. Turn off heat.
  • Add bread pieces. Mix gently. Let the bread soak the flavors for 2-3 mins before serving.
  • Garnish with some fresh cilantro and serve hot. Enjoy!!

Video

Notes

1. If you like the consistency of bread upma to be moist but not mushy, add around 1 cup of water. For more dry bread upma, use only ¾ cup or even less water.
2. For Instant Pot, cooking time is only "1" mins since, I have chopped potatoes into small pieces. Depending upon the size of the potatoes adjust the pressure cook time.
